Abstract
A method and apparatus for air-ground detection. A truck beam of a semi-levered landing gear is mounted on a pivot pin. The truck beam is configured to rotate about the pivot pin between a toes down position and a toes up position. A positioning mechanism is connected to a locking mechanism that secures an angle of the truck beam in the toes up position. The locking mechanism is secured in a steady state and configured to change from the steady state to a locked state in response to an initial ground contact. A sensor is connected to the locking mechanism. The sensor is configured to detect a change from the steady state to the locked state.

10. A method for air-ground detection in a semi-levered landing gear, the method comprising:
-
monitoring an orientation of a number of links of a semi-levered linkage assembly using a sensor connected to the semi-levered linkage assembly, wherein the sensor is configured to detect a change from the steady state to the locked state without requiring a change in shock strut compression; and responsive to detecting a change in the orientation of the semi-levered linkage assembly from a steady state to a locked state, indicating an initial ground contact position of the semi-levered landing gear. - View Dependent Claims (11, 12, 13, 14, 21, 22, 23, 24, 25)
